The article provides an insightful overview of how Strapi, a headless CMS, is utilized by the author's marketing team to manage their website content efficiently. The piece highlights Strapi's customization capabilities, its SEO friendliness, and the integration with various frontend frameworks like Next.js, showcasing its versatility and adaptability for developers and non-technical users alike. By leveraging features such as Dynamic Zones, webhooks, and Role-Based Access Control (RBAC), Strapi enables teams to create and manage content with flexibility, fostering creativity and collaboration. The article also emphasizes the ease with which Strapi facilitates the creation of landing pages, previews, and custom workflows, making it a valuable tool for managing web content. Through practical examples, such as their FoodAdvisor demo app, the article illustrates Strapi's practical applications and encourages users to explore its potential, supported by a strong community and resources for further guidance.
